The Southridge Spartans will challenge the South Dade Buccaneers at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Southridge's defense has only allowed 11.1 points per game this season, so South Dade's offense will have their work cut out for them.
Southridge is probably headed into the matchup with a chip on their shoulder considering Booker T. Washington just ended the team's seven-game winning streak last Friday. They took a 27-14 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Tornadoes. The Spartans haven't had much luck with the Tornadoes recently, as the team's come up short the last four times they've met.
William Williams put forth a good effort for the losing side as he rushed for 75 yards and a touchdown on only six carries.
Meanwhile, South Dade had already won two in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 39.5 points) and they went ahead and made it three on Thursday. They blew past the Cavaliers 38-0. With that win, the Buccaneers brought their scoring average up to 27.6 points per game.
X?Zayvion Clayton had an outrageously good game as he threw for 228 yards and three touchdowns while completing 75% of his passes. Sedric Melvin helped Clayton out on the ground, rushing for 68 yards and a touchdown on only eight carries.
Southridge's defeat ended a four-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 7-2. As for South Dade, they now have a winning record of 5-4.
Southridge couldn't quite finish off South Dade when the teams last played back in November of 2023 and fell 33-30. Can Southridge av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
